The Xiaomi Redmi Note 9 Pro is a bit better than Moto G50, getting an 81.1 score against 75.3. Xiaomi Redmi Note 9 Pro's construction has the same thickness than the Moto G50, but it's a little bit heavier. These devices use Android OS, but Xiaomi Redmi Note 9 Pro has the previous 10 version while Moto G50 has Android 11 version.
Xiaomi Redmi Note 9 Pro features a bit faster processor than Motorola Moto G50, and although they both have a Octa-Core CPU, the Xiaomi Redmi Note 9 Pro also has more RAM memory. Xiaomi Redmi Note 9 Pro has a more vivid display than Moto G50, because it has a little bigger display, more pixels per display inch and a much higher resolution of 1080 x 2400 pixels.
Moto G50 has a better storage to install applications and games or saving photos and videos than Xiaomi Redmi Note 9 Pro, and although they both have exactly the same 64 GB internal memory, the Moto G50 also has a SD memory slot that supports a maximum of 1 TB. The Xiaomi Redmi Note 9 Pro features a battery performance that is very similar to the Moto G50 one, although the Xiaomi Redmi Note 9 Pro also has a 0% more battery capacity.
The Xiaomi Redmi Note 9 Pro has a greater camera than Motorola Moto G50, because although it has a tinier aperture which is not recommended for low-light photos and videos, it also counts with a camera with a way better resolution.
